How to Choose a Web Development Company | Expert Guide 2025

Choosing the right web development company is one of the most critical decisions for any business aiming to establish a strong digital presence. Whether you’re a startup, a small business, or an enterprise, your website is often the first impression your audience will have of your brand. A well-designed and functional website can boost your visibility, engage customers, and drive revenue. Here’s a comprehensive guide to help you choose the best web development company for your needs.

1. Define Your Requirements Clearly

Before you begin your search, take the time to clearly define your project goals. Ask yourself:

  • What is the purpose of your website? (e.g., eCommerce, informational, portfolio, lead generation)
  • What features do you need? (e.g., contact forms, payment integration, CMS, user login)
  • Do you have any design preferences or branding guidelines?
  • What is your expected timeline and budget?

Having clear answers to these questions will help you communicate effectively with potential development partners and ensure you find a team that aligns with your vision.


2. Review the Company’s Portfolio

A company’s past work can give you a good sense of their design style, technical capabilities, and industry experience. Look for:

  • Variety and quality of previous projects
  • Responsive design and user-friendly interfaces
  • Functionality and performance of websites
  • Experience with similar businesses or industries

If possible, visit the live websites listed in their portfolio and evaluate the user experience firsthand.


3. Check Client Reviews and Testimonials

Customer feedback offers invaluable insights into the reliability and professionalism of a web development company. Check platforms like Clutch, Google Reviews, or the testimonials section on the company’s website.

Pay attention to:

  • Client satisfaction
  • Project delivery timelines
  • Communication effectiveness
  • Post-launch support and maintenance

Don’t hesitate to reach out to past clients for more direct feedback.


4. Evaluate Technical Expertise

A web development company should have strong technical skills across various platforms and technologies. Depending on your requirements, check if they have expertise in:

  • Front-end languages (HTML, CSS, JavaScript)
  • Back-end technologies (PHP, Python, Node.js, Ruby)
  • Content Management Systems (WordPress, Magento, Drupal, Shopify)
  • Frameworks (Laravel, React, Angular, Vue.js)
  • Database management and hosting solutions

Ask about their development process, quality assurance practices, and how they ensure cross-browser compatibility and responsive design.


5. Assess Their Communication and Project Management Skills

Efficient communication and smooth project management are essential for a successful collaboration. Look for a company that:

  • Assigns a dedicated project manager
  • Uses project management tools (like Jira, Trello, Asana)
  • Provides regular updates and reports
  • Offers transparent communication channels (email, chat, video calls)

Poor communication can lead to misunderstandings, delays, and a final product that doesn’t meet your expectations.


6. Understand Their Development Process

Ask the company to walk you through their development process. A well-structured process often includes:

  • Requirement gathering
  • Wireframing and prototyping
  • Design and development
  • Testing and quality assurance
  • Launch and deployment
  • Post-launch support

Make sure their process aligns with your preferred workflow and provides checkpoints for feedback and approval.


7. Discuss Maintenance and Support

A website needs regular updates, bug fixes, and security patches. Choose a web development company that offers:

  • Ongoing maintenance plans
  • Technical support after project completion
  • Prompt response to issues or downtime

Support services ensure that your website continues to function optimally and stays secure over time.


8. Consider Scalability and Future Growth

Your business needs may evolve over time. Select a web development partner who can scale your website accordingly. Discuss:

  • How easy it is to add new features or pages
  • Integration capabilities with third-party tools and APIs
  • Future redesign or upgrade possibilities

A scalable website helps accommodate growth and changes without needing a complete overhaul.


9. Review Pricing and Value for Money

While cost shouldn’t be the sole deciding factor, it’s important to understand the pricing structure. Compare:

  • Fixed pricing vs hourly rates
  • What’s included in the cost (design, development, testing, support)
  • Additional charges for future updates or changes

Investing in a reputable company might seem expensive upfront but can save you time, money, and frustration in the long run.


10. Trust Your Instincts and Chemistry

Finally, go with a team you feel comfortable working with. Trust and collaboration are key to a successful project. A good web development company will:

  • Listen to your ideas
  • Provide constructive suggestions
  • Be responsive and transparent

The right partner will treat your website as a long-term asset and be genuinely invested in your success.

Conclusion

Choosing the right web development company requires time, research, and careful consideration. By defining your goals, reviewing portfolios, evaluating technical skills, and ensuring effective communication, you can find a partner who will bring your vision to life.

Remember, your website is more than just a digital address—it’s a powerful tool to represent your brand, connect with customers, and grow your business. Make the right choice, and the returns will be worth the investment.

Depo 25 Bonus 25

Depo 25 Bonus 25